Summary

The objective of this biospecimen collection protocol is the acquisition of blood from adult volunteers. These biospecimens will be transferred to the College of Medicine (COM)/Burnett School of Biomedical Sciences (BSBS) research scientists and their research teams for testing according to their separate IRB-approved/exempted protocols. These separate IRBapproved protocols cannot be for genetic testing.

Detailed description

Research scientists of the University of Central Florida College of Medicine (COM) and Burnett School of Biomedical Sciences (BSBS) conduct laboratory studies in biomedical and translational research for the purpose of understanding human disease and developing innovative methods for diagnosing, measuring, or treating disease or disease symptoms. The key research divisions are cancer, cardiovascular, immunity and pathogenesis, neuroscience, and molecular microbiology. Frequently, these studies require human blood (or its derivatives) for testing of assays and devices.
